Rare and unadulterated

Posted by Robin on 18 June 2019 8 Comments

‘People often speak about New Zealand’s distinctive light,’ says Bowler. ‘And the same can be said for its unique odour profile – it’s woody, balsamic, mossy and green with a saltiness in the air. Our native flora doesn’t present the big tropical floralcy that one might expect from a South Pacific island, but what we do have is rare and unadulterated. And this earthy imprint has a massive influence on the emerging style of New Zealand perfumery.’

— Perfumer George Bowler, talking about New Zealand's indie perfume scene. Read more at Fresh fields: New Zealand’s noses are the new kids on the niche perfume block at Wallpaper.
